Best time to go to Newcastle

The best time to visit Newcastle is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. September is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. February and March are its coolest month on average. At the time of March,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January78.6°F (25.9°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
February77.9°F (25.5°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
March77.9°F (25.5°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
April78.8°F (26.0°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
May80.4°F (26.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June81.7°F (27.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
July82.0°F (27.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August82.6°F (28.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September83.1°F (28.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
October82.6°F (28.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
November81.3°F (27.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
December79.7°F (26.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Newcastle

Flying into Newcastle, Saint James Windward Parish, St. Kitts and Nevis is convenient with two major airports nearby. Vance W. Amory International Airport (NEV) is located 644m from Newcastle, making it easily accessible. Nearby accommodation options include the Mount Nevis Hotel, just 966m away, and The Hamilton Beach Villas & Spa, which is 5km from the airport. Robert L. Bradshaw International Airport (SKB) is 18km away, with excellent hotels such as the 5-star Park Hyatt St. Kitts, situated 13km from the airport. Both airports offer various transportation services, ensuring a smooth transition from hotel to airport.

What's the seasonal weather like in Newcastle?
The hottest months are usually September and August,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are February and March, with an average of 26°C. Average annual precipitation for Newcastle is 888 mm.
